THE air ambulance was sent to help a woman fighting for life in Amblecote.
Medics were called to a woman in a critical condition at an address in Platts Crescent, at 3.23pm today (Tuesday October 26).
The woman was given advanced life support and was taken to hospital.
A spokesman for West Midlands Ambulance Service said: “We were called to reports of a medical emergency at an address in Platts Crescent, Amblecote.
"We sent two ambulances, two paramedic officers, the Midlands Air Ambulance from Cosford and the Midlands Air Ambulance Critical Care Car.
"On arrival, crews found a woman in a critical condition.
"Staff administered advanced life support at the scene and continued treatment enroute to hospital via land ambulance.”
